It was a scene straight out of a blockbuster movie, but this was real life. Former India all-rounder Abhishek Nayar transformed into an impromptu bodyguard for Rohit Sharma, shielding the star batter from a sea of overzealous fans at Mumbai’s iconic Shivaji Park. The chaotic moment, now a viral sensation, has reignited conversations about fan frenzy and player safety in Indian cricket.

Rohit Sharma’s Intense Training Session Turns Chaotic

On a Friday afternoon in October 2025, Rohit Sharma was deep in preparation for the upcoming high-stakes tour of Australia. His chosen ground? The historic Shivaji Park, a nursery for countless Mumbai and Indian cricket legends. However, what was meant to be a focused training session quickly spiraled into chaos as thousands of fans gathered, desperate for a glimpse of their hero .

The crowd’s passion, while a testament to Rohit’s immense popularity, became a serious safety hazard. In a now-famous clip, Abhishek Nayar, who was assisting Rohit with his training, can be seen physically creating a barrier between the star and the surging crowd. His desperate plea, “Usko lagna nahi chahiye!” (He shouldn’t get hit!), echoed through the park, a raw moment of concern for his friend and former teammate .

Abhishek Nayar: From Cricket All-Rounder to Protector

Abhishek Nayar is no stranger to the cricketing world. A stalwart of Mumbai cricket, he played 3 ODIs for India and has an impressive domestic record, amassing over 5,700 runs in first-class cricket with a stellar average of 45.62 . His deep understanding of the game and his close bond with Rohit made him the perfect training partner for this crucial pre-tour camp.

His actions at Shivaji Park, however, showcased a different kind of strength—loyalty and quick thinking. In a moment of crisis, he didn’t hesitate to put his friend’s safety first, a gesture that has won him admiration from fans and fellow cricketers alike.

The Stakes: India’s Crucial Australia Tour

This intense training session wasn’t just for show. Rohit Sharma is gearing up for a pivotal three-match ODI series against Australia, which kicks off on October 19, 2025, in Perth . This tour is a critical part of India’s build-up to the 2027 ODI World Cup, and every net session counts.

Here’s a quick look at the upcoming schedule:

Match Date Venue
1st ODI October 19, 2025 Perth Stadium, Perth
2nd ODI October 23, 2025 Adelaide Oval, Adelaide
3rd ODI October 25, 2025 Sydney Cricket Ground, Sydney

The Indian team is scheduled to depart for Australia on October 15, leaving very little room for error or injury in their final preparations .
